Ethics Agency Says Bryan Bedford, FAA Chief, Didn’t Divest Republic Airways Holdings

The Office of Government Ethics told senators that Bryan Bedford, the F.A.A. administrator, did not divest from the airline he previously ran as he had agreed.

Bryan Bedford was the chairman and chief executive of Republic Airways before being confirmed as the administrator of the Federal Aviation Administration earlier this year.
